Ingredients cook Sticky chocolate chip and ginger cookies

  1. Prepare 110 gr rolled oats.
  2. You need 110 gr flour (I used brown).
  3. You need 1 tsp. baking powder.
  4. Prepare 110 gr. butter.
  5. It's 1 tablespoon maple syrup.
  6. You need 100 gr soft brown sugar.
  7. Prepare few pieces crystalised ginger.
  8. It's 1 small portion chocolate chips.
  9. You need 1 tsp. ground ginger.

Sticky chocolate chip and ginger cookies instructions

  1. Get the ingredients together and put the oven on at 170ΒΊ.
  2. Melt the butter in a small pan with the syrup and sugar over a very gentle heat.
  3. Chop the ginger into tiny pieces and put in a large bowl with the other dry ingredientes, except the chocolate.
  4. Once the sugar has dissolved.
  5. Add the pan's contents to the bowl.
  6. Mix well.
  7. And when the mixture has cooled down a bit, add the chocolate chips.
  8. Put small portions on a sheet of greaseproof paper on a baking tray and flatten them a little with a spoon. This amount will give you enough to do 2 batches..
  9. And put in the hot oven for 25 minutes.
  10. Put them to cool on a cooling rack but only after leaving them for a few minutes on the baking tray - if they are too just-out-of-the-oven, they will crumble.
